How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 49506?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| 49506 Studio Apartments | $1,112 | $955 | $1,355 |
| 49506 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,434 | $975 | $2,762 |
| 49506 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,786 | $1,095 | $2,535 |
| 49506 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,965 | $1,100 | $2,845 |
| 49506 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,695 | $1,695 | $1,695 |
